GARY DAMICO

Gary was first elected to the Fredonia Village Board in 2001 and is now in his second term.  Born in Dunkirk, Mr. Damico has been a resident of Fredonia for 31 years and an active member of both communities.  Mr. Damico's past involvement includes President of both Dunkirk and Fredonia Chambers of Commerce, Board Member Fredonia Farm Festival, Board member Dunkirk Local Development corp., Chairman Chautauqua County Small Business Advisory Board.  Currently Mr. Damico is serving as President of Dunkirk Free Library, Board of Directors Dunkirk Chamber of Commerce, Treasurer Chautauqua Multiuse Development Committee, and Co-Chairs the shared public works committee between Dunkirk and Fredonia looking to build a new Joint Police Department.

In 1992 Mr. Damico received the Fredonia State Business Club, "Person of the Year Award".

A successful Businessman, Mr. Damico served as Manager and then owner operator of Freshmart Supermarket in Fredonia.  Currently he is the co-owner of P&G Foods in Dunkirk with his wife Patricia.  In 2003, the Damico's were honored by the Dunkirk Chamber of Commerce with the "Business Achievement Award".

Mr. Damico and his wife Patricia have three children:  Brandi, a SUNY Fredonia Graduate is a Kindegarten Teacher in the Dunkirk School System, Joshua is a Supervisor for GEICO Insurance and lives in Lockport, N.Y., and Michael is in his second year at SUNY Fredonia.
